BTEC Fitness
Components of fitness and training mehods
Question | Answer |
---|---|
Match the definition: the ability of the cardiovascular and respiratory systems to work to take in and deliver oxygen to muscles over a long period of time to delay fatigue | Aerobic endurance |
Match the definition: The ability to overcome a resistance. Static holding a position (isometric) & explosive (rapid application) | Muscular Strength |
Match the definition: The rate at which the body is moved from one place to another | Speed |
Match the definition: Rapid application of muscular force (a combination of speed and strength) | Power |
Match the definition: the range of movement at a joint | Flexibility |
Match the definition: ability of a muscle or group of muscles to perform repetitive contractions over a period of time | Muscular endurance |
What training methods can be used to improve aerobic endurance | continuous training, fartlek training, interval training; |
What training methods can be used to improve Muscular endurance | circuit training, core stability training, medicine ball training; |
What training methods can be used to improve muscular Strength | free weights, resistance machines |
What training methods can be used to improve Power | plyometrics, anaerobic hill sprints; |
What training methods can be used to improve Speed | interval training, sport specific speed training (Parachute Running) |
What training methods can be used to improve Flexibility | e.g. static stretching, ballistic stretching, proprioceptive neuromuscular facilitation (PNF) stretching |
